memmap
Syntax
memmap[-b][-sfo]
Description
Displays the system memory map.
Options
-b
-
Displays one screen at a time.
-sfo
-
Displays standard formatted output in a detailed and a summary table.
Usage
The memory map keeps track of all the physical memory in the system and how it is currently being used.
Example
To display the system memory map:
fs0:\> memmap
Type Start End # Pages Attributes
available 0000000000750000-0000000001841FFF 00000000000010F2 0000000000000009
LoaderCode 0000000001842000-00000000018A3FFF 0000000000000062 0000000000000009
available 00000000018A4000-00000000018C1FFF 000000000000001E 0000000000000009
LoaderData 00000000018C2000-00000000018CAFFF 0000000000000009 0000000000000009
BS_code 00000000018CB000-0000000001905FFF 000000000000003B 0000000000000009
BS_data 0000000001906000-00000000019C9FFF 00000000000000C4 0000000000000009
...
RT_data 0000000001B2B000-0000000001B2BFFF 0000000000000001 8000000000000009
BS_data 0000000001B2C000-0000000001B4FFFF 0000000000000024 0000000000000009
reserved 0000000001B50000-0000000001D4FFFF 0000000000000200 0000000000000009
reserved : 512 Pages (2,097,152)
LoaderCode: 98 Pages (401,408)
LoaderData: 32 Pages (131,072)
BS_code : 335 Pages (1,372,160)
BS_data : 267 Pages (1,093,632)
RT_data : 19 Pages (77,824)
available : 4,369 Pages (17,895,424)
Total Memory: 20 MB (20,971,520) Bytes
Output details
The following table describes the possible output for this command.
Column |
Description |
---|---|
Type
|
Type of memory. Options are:
|
Start
|
Starting address. |
End
|
Ending address. |
# Pages
|
Number of 4 KB pages. |
reserved
|
Reserved memory total size in bytes. |
LoaderCode
|
Loader code total size in bytes. |
LoaderData
|
Loader data total size in bytes. |
BS_code
|
Boot service code total size in bytes. |
BS_data
|
Boot service data total size in bytes. |
RT_data
|
Runtime data total size in bytes. |
available
|
Available memory in bytes. |
Total Memory
|
Total memory size in bytes. |
